Shuffling Scythe Blades

Hazard 8 — magical, mechanical, trap

Pre-Remaster content. May include legacy alignment.

Six long blades, hidden in grooves in the walls and floor, zigzag through different parts of this hallway when any pressure plate in the hallway intersection is depressed; there are so many plates it's impossible to avoid them when moving through the room. The blades retreat into the floor and move through the hidden grooves before swinging out from the wall again in a different location.

Dicing Scythes
Scythe Shuffle — The blades travel erratically throughout the hallway's branches, out of sight under the floors or behind the walls. For each blade, roll 1d4 to determine the region in which it next makes scythe Strikes. A creature can Seek to learn clues about blades in the region they're currently occupying. On a success, the creature knows how many blades are currently in its region.

1. Main intersection (the 15-foot-by-25-foot area where the hallways connect, as marked on area E20)

2. North branch (from the main intersection to the secret door to area E14)

3. Central hall (from the main intersection to the secret door to area E24)

4. South branch (from the main intersection to the wall shared with area E25)
